卵巢基础状态对促超排卵结局的预测 被引量:19

Basic Ovarian Status and Follicular Response to Superovulation Stimulation in an in Vitro Fertilization and Embryo Transfer Program

摘要 目的:探讨病人的年龄、双侧卵巢基础状态及血清基础雌二醇(E2)水平与促超排卵后卵巢反应之间的关系。方法:对基础血清促卵泡激素(FSH)<20IU/L、月经周期规律的女性不孕症病人102例、102个体外受精-胚胎移植周期,给予相同的促超排卵方案后,根据直径>10mm的卵泡数目将卵巢反应分为3种类型:低反应型(卵泡数<3个)、中反应型(卵泡数3~14个)和高反应型(卵泡数>14个)。结果:(1)年龄大于35岁者卵巢低反应型的发生率增高,而小于30岁者有发生高反应型的趋势。(2)卵巢基础状态的卵泡数目与促超排卵后卵泡发育数目呈正相关(P<0.001),当基础状态的双侧卵泡数多于20时,极有可能发生卵巢高反应。(3)基础状态最大卵泡直径对卵巢反应类型有显著影响,当其直径大于4mm时,卵巢低反应型的发生率明显增加。(4)各反应类型之间基础血清E2水平无显著差异(P>0.05)。结论:年龄和双侧卵巢的基础状态,是预测促超排卵后的卵巢反应的重要因素。 Objective: To study the relationship between patient age, cycle day 3 basal ovarian status, serum estradiol (E 2) level and the ovarian response in an in vitro fertilization and embryo transfer (IVF ET) program. Method: 102 cases and 102 cycles of IVF ET patients with regular menstrual period and normal cycle day 3 basal follicular stimulating hormone (FSH<20 IU/L) level were studied. The same superovulation regimen was empolyed. The ovarian response was classified as low when follicle number (diameter>10mm) was fewer than 3 on the day of hCG injection, moderate when the number was 3~14, and high when follicle number exceeded 14. Results: (1) Patients older than 35 years tended to be low responders; women younger than 30 years usually responded well with production of more than 15 follicles. (2) The number of cycle day 3 follicles was positively correlated with the number after stimulation with gonadotropin. When total basal follicle number in both ovary exceeded 20, ovarian hyperstimulation syndrome should be watched out. (3) On cycle day 3 the diameter of the largest follicle was negatively correlated with the ovarian response. In low responders the diameter of the largest follicle was usually larger than 4mm. (4) Despite of the different size and number of the cycle day 3 follicles the serum E 2 level was quite similar. Conclusion: Age and basal ovarian status including the number and size of the antral follicles are valuable factors to be considered in the prediction of ovarian response to the same gonadotrophic stimulation protocol.
